hey mensen,,
ik heb een soort interview script maar nu heb ik ook een form waarin je zeg maar een entry kan bewerken dat doe ik als volgt
<?
if ($action == "wijziginterview")
{
$intsql = mysql_query("SELECT * FROM interviews where id = '".$_GET['id']."'");
$res = mysql_fetch_array($intsql);
if(!$naam || !$inhoud || !$woonplaats || !$door)
{
echo "
<center>
<BR>
<center>
<table cellpadding=3>
<tr>
<td align=center>
<form action=\"\" method=\"post\">
Naam van de persoon:<BR>
<input type=\"text\" name=\"naam\" value=\"$res[naam]\"><BR><BR>
geboortedatum vul in als bijv 10 Jan 2006<BR>
<input type=\"text\" name=\"geboortedatum\" value=\"$res[geboortedatum]\"><BR><BR>
Sterrenbeeld:<BR>
<input type=\"text\" name=\"sterrenbeeld\" value=\"$res[sterrenbeeld]\"><BR><BR>
woonplaats<BR>
<input type=\"text\" name=\"woonplaats\" value=\"$res[woonplaats]\"><BR><BR>
website:<BR>
<input type=\"text\" name=\"website\" value=\"$res[website]\"><BR><BR>
door:<BR>
<input type=\"text\" name=\"door\" value=\"$res[door]\"><BR><BR>
<textarea name=\"inhoud\" rows=\"25\" cols=\"59\">$res[inhoud]</textarea>
<input type=\"submit\" value=\"update\">
</form>
</td>
</tr>
</table>
</center>
<BR>
";
}
else {
$naam=$_POST['naam'];
$geboortedatum=$_POST['geboortedatum'];
$sterrenbeeld=$_POST['sterrenbeeld'];
$woonplaats=$_POST['woonplaats'];
$website=$_POST['website'];
$door=$_POST['door'];
$inhoud=$_POST['inhoud'];
$result3 = mysql_query("update interviews naam='$naam', geboortedatum='$geboortedatum', sterrenbeeld='$sterrenbeeld', woonplaats='$woonplaats', website='$website', door='$door', inhoud='$inhoud', where id='".$_GET['id']."'");
mysql_query($result3);
echo "geupdate.";
}
}
?>
het rare is wanneer ik op submit klik dat hij dan zegt geupdate maar niks heeft veranderd?????//
en als ik check met mysql error zegt hij query is empty????
hoe los ik dit op ?
1.071 views